Installation Notes and Tips
Verify rotor dimensions against the original part before installation, including outside diameter, height, bolt hole diameter, and thickness measurements. Confirm the vehicle’s brake setup uses a solid rotor with a 4-bolt pattern before ordering. For Honda Civic brake rotor replacement searches and other make/model lookups, match the application by size and mounting details rather than appearance alone. Clean the hub mounting surface and inspect pads, caliper hardware, and wheel bearings during brake service.
